Igor Vayshenker is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Igor Vayshenker has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 8 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 7 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Igor Vayshenker’s work include Photonic and Optical Devices (12 papers), Calibration and Measurement Techniques (8 papers) and Fiber Optic Sensor Technology (7 papers). Igor Vayshenker is often cited by papers focused on Photonic and Optical Devices (12 papers), Calibration and Measurement Techniques (8 papers) and Fiber Optic Sensor Technology (7 papers). Igor Vayshenker collaborates with scholars based in United States, Egypt and Japan. Igor Vayshenker's co-authors include Sae Woo Nam, Adriana E. Lita, Richard P. Mirin, Matthew D. Shaw, Thomas Gerrits, Varun B. Verma, J. A. Stern, Francesco Marsili, Burm Baek and Sean D. Harrington and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Photonics, Optics Express and Measurement Science and Technology.
